Although most immigrants come to live permanently in the United States through a family member’s sponsorship, employment, or a job offer, there are many other ways to get a green card (permanent residence).
These special adjustment programs are limited to individuals meeting particular qualifications and/or applying during certain time frames.
The Other Immigrant Visa categories are as follows:
-
Amerasian Child of a U.S. Citizen
-
American Indian Born in Canada
-
Armed Forces Member
-
Cuban Native or Citizen
-
Diversity Immigrant Visa Program
-
Haitian Refugee
-
Help HAITI Act of 2010
-
Indochinese Parole Adjustment Act
-
Informant (S Nonimmigrant)
-
Lautenberg Parolee
-
Legal Immigration Family Equity (LIFE) Act
-
Person Born to Foreign Diplomat in United States
-
Registry
-
Section 13 (Diplomat)
-
Victim of Criminal Activity (U Nonimmigrant)
-
Victim of Trafficking (T Nonimmigrant)
-
Nicaraguan and Central American Relief Act (NACARA)
